you mean synths and daws? well, the best daw to get is ableton (though some swear by cubase) and one of the best vst packages is kontakt. (a daw is the player/mixer, vsts are the intruments). another great one is LA scoring strings.

though they aren't free (unless you have the knowing of the interwebs)
